Leviska Shenault Jr. takes backward pass 41 yards for Panthers TD

The pass was thrown backward and behind the line of scrimmage.

So, PJ Walker doesn’t get credit for a TD toss.

Rather, Laviska Shenault Jr. is credited for a 41-yard touchdown run that gave the Carolina Panthers a 10-0 lead over the Atlanta Falcons after the PAT on Thursday Night Football.

The weather was putting a damper on the scoring but not the Carolina ground game. Remember, these teams combined for 71 points a couple of weeks ago.

The Panthers added another field goal and got an interception of Marcus Mariota by Jaycee Horn in the second quarter.

Atlanta’s performance could be described in one word: Listless.
